Ohio Support Staff Institute Closing Session |
|
The Ohio Support Staff Institute would like to issue an invitation to the library community throughout the state and to those in nearby areas to come and join us for our closing session for the August 2002 Institute. On Wednesday August 7th from 9:00-11:30 a.m. we will hold the closing session for the Institute, entitled "Technology Futures, Libraries, and You", a panel session that includes some of the most dynamic, involved, and perceptive members of Ohio's library community today. The panel includes Mr. Tom Sanville, Executive Director of OhioLINK, the statewide consortia for Ohio's university and college libraries; Mr. Michael Lucas, the State Librarian of Ohio and Ms. Theresa M. Fredericka, Executive Director of INFOhio, the information network for Ohio's schools. Join us as we get a unique view from each of our panelists on these subjects. This session is offered free and is open to the public. We hope you will join us on the Ohio Dominican College campus on Wednesday August 7th, 2002! Douglas Morrison (morrison.244@osu.edu) |

Mary Reis and Jan Wagner |
University Libraries congratulates Mary Reis and Jan Wagner on their Spot Bonus awards. Ordinarily, Mary and Jan are engaged in processing new materials, supervising students, and assisting Library patrons. In addition to these daily activities, Mary and Jan have accomplished several special projects in the Microforms/Periodicals Room. They have re-configured the space in MIC without adding cabinet and shelving units. The project required them to prepare to move two large microprint sets out of MIC and into the Ohio State University Book Depository. They created item records, and worked on labeling, barcoding, and processing for these microprint sets: 1,158 boxes of United State Government non-depository publications and 266 boxes of the British House of Commons sessional papers. Mary and Jan are also completing a project designed to retain microfilm newspapers while not adding microform cabinets in MIC. Their work on this project has entailed barcoding and building item records for all newspapers, and sending selected titles to storage. Approximately 2,200 reels of microfilm have been sent to the depository as part of this project. Their creative recommendations for alternate placement, exchange and use of shelving for Reference tools, audiotapes, CD-ROMS, and newspapers saved the Libraries approximately $6,000. This money originally had been approved to purchase counter height shelving for the MIC Reference tools. A counter height shelving unit from ISD had been designated for MIC, but Jan and Mary suggested that the unit go to the Government Documents Collection to give that area a more open look while accommodating shelving requirements for MIC. When you visit the Microforms/Periodicals Room, you'll immediately notice a change in the way the room is arranged and space, utilized. Previously, four cabinet units and two rows of tall shelving blocked the view to the windows. Jan and Mary created special arrangements that allow for a view of the windows in that area. Spaces throughout the Main Library have been improved and upgraded, due to the commitment of Library faculty and staff like Mary and Jan, who make the Libraries an outstanding place to work and study. Libraries Represented at Denman |
![]() Professor Maureen Donovan and Alexandra Leslie Alexandra (Alex) Leslie, a senior, Japanese major from Australia, participated in the Richard J. and Martha D. Denman Undergraduate Research Forum on May 21, 2002. Alex's project, "Analyzing Japanese Hospitality Web Sites" studied the World Wide Web as implemented in Japan. The purpose of her project was to collect and analyze data on the use of the web in the Japanese Hospitality Industry and to develop a strategy that teachers could teach to intermediate-level students of Japanese to enable them to find quality information. Alex's Japanese major focuses on literature and linguistics, but she has a special interest in the hospitality industry. Maureen Donovan, Associate Professor and Japanese Studies Librarian, has been Alex's instructor for J693, Individual Studies. Alex is a student assistant in East Asian Studies - Japanese, assisting Professor Donovan on a project to catalog Japanese websites of a scholarly interest for a database for the Digital Asia Library, based at the University of Wisconsin. The Denman Undergraduate Research Forum encourages undergraduates to participate in research to enhance their educational experience and to enrich their learning. In addition, the Forum seeks to develop the capacity of all undergraduates to make contributions to science and society. Chiquita Mullins Lee (mullins-lee.1@osu.edu) |
